The Municipal Shelter, the Escuela Superior de Diseño de Aragón and the Centro de Historias collaborate to rethink, from the point of view of design, the reception spaces.
The situation of homeless people in the neighbourhood has worsened in recent months. Faced with this scenario, the project Co-Design at the Hostel promotes a participatory process that brings together users of the Shelter, staff of the History Centre, ESDA students, design professionals and the neighbourhood to jointly imagine and develop improvements to the facility.
The process began on 3 October at the Escuela Superior de Diseño de Aragón with a day of presentation and collective reflection on the role of design in social transformation. The next session will be held on 24 October at 10:00 a.m.between the History Centre and the Municipal Shelterand will be open to public participation.












During this day, the teams will analyse the hostel spaces, identify their uses and propose interventions to help improve their functionality, accessibility and warmth. The project aims to redefine the uses of the Shelter after its expansion, promoting a human, inclusive and community approach.
